Ethel Russell Obituary

Russell, Ethel Louise,

78 of Louisville passed away.

She was a retired Personnel Director for Jacobson's department store, and member of Southeast Christian Church.

Ethel Louise is preceded in death by her husband Wayne David Russell and her special friend, Jesse the cat.

She is survived by her nieces and nephews, Norma Young, Paul Hart (Pamela), Perry Smith, Renee Seely (Mike), Robert Smith (Dosie), Selena Hicks (Denny), Celeste Shields (Joe Bill), Dirk Tarter and Devin Tarter and many other extended family members and friends.

A funeral service to celebrate Ethel Louise's life will be conducted at 12 noon on Tuesday, November 10, 2015 in the chapel of Arch L. Heady at Resthaven, 4400 Bardstown Rd with an interment to follow at Resthaven Memorial Park. Guests are invited to attend a visitation from 3-8pm and after 9am the day of the funeral.

Expressions of sympathy may be made to the Kentucky Humane Society.
